Position Focus:

Collaborate on research projects in the fields of economics, statistics, and geosciences. Will direct and co-direct projects in these fields. Responsible for proficiency in use of GIS software (e.g. ArcMap) and econometric analysis, gathering data, performing statistical analysis, and writing of reports. Wide range of language skills will be useful.

This will be accomplished by performing a variety of duties including: developing data sets, manipulating and examining data files including national income accounting and developing integrated assessment modeling and participating in the development of operations and procedures for the collection, editing, verification and management of statistical data and geographical information systems such as ArcGIS.


Essential Duties

1. Performs a variety of duties involving the application of statistical skills to the design of research studies. Works as a member of a research team/study team to provide appropriate statistical input in the design, execution and analysis of studies. 2. Participates in the development of operations and procedures for the collection, editing, verification and management of statistical data. 3. Operates one or more systems of computer hardware and statistical analysis software for the management and analysis of data. Evaluates the statistical methods and procedures used to obtain data to ensure validity, applicability, efficiency, and accuracy. 4. Analyzes and interprets statistical data to identify significant differences in relationships among sources of information. 5. Processes large amounts of data for statistical modeling and graphic analysis, using computers. 6. Investigates, evaluates and prepares reports on applicability, efficiency, and accuracy of statistical methods used in obtaining and evaluation data. 7. Participates in the preparation of written and oral presentations that summarize the analysis of data, interprets the finding and provides conclusions and recommendations. 8. May perform other duties as assigned.
